Due to its popularity, Genesis became a label in its own right in 2006. The serial number is stamped into the bottom of the frame (under the bottom bracket).

These are Genesis’ entry-level road bikes and are the cheapest in their range. The geometry genesis bicycles is a little more upright, making for a more comfortable and less twitchy ride. There are mounts for mudguards and a pannier rack, which expands the range of use from just road riding to commuting and even lightweight cycle touring.
